A Halloween haunted house is not complete without a creepy spider web. It adds to the spooky atmosphere and makes everything look older. It is also very effective when set up so that people have to walk through it. A stretchy spider web will work best if it can stretch across a room or a mirror. Make sure to tease the threads so they are not easy to pull apart. Another creepy way to use spider webs is to drape them over doors and furniture.

Another option for a Halloween haunted house is to make the house into a nuclear disaster zone. To do this, search for pictures of nuclear disaster zones and use them as inspiration for your haunted house. If possible, make signs in the shape of a nuclear bomb and wear gas masks or hazmat suits. Make sure the area looks abandoned and unoccupied. Blinking lights should be avoided in this type of haunted house, as they may scare small children and make them jumpy.

Haunted houses have a history that dates back to the 19th century. The popularity of haunted houses among Christians has led to Christian attractions called "Scaremares". These haunted attractions feature demons and Satan to spook visitors, and also offer a chance to learn about Christian salvation. A home haunt is an extremely popular version of a haunted house that is held in a person's yard or home. These haunts are free to attend and are often run by community members as fundraisers.
